    This spot is near my house, and I like to come here sometimes to get a quick & cheap meal. Literally two of my meals only costed $10. Of course, you get what you pay for. It's not the best burgers around or anything, but it's convenient & affordable for those types of days. Their fries are a hit-or-miss too. Some days they're terrible and some days they're "fresh." I do like that their burgers are smaller (compared to McDonalds & BK) and doesn't make you grossly full. Their chili is pretty decent, but the best thing on their menu is their milkshake!

    If you're on US-49 near the US-98 junction on the outskirts of Hattiesburg Mississippi, you're…read morelikely to see a truck stop called Dan's Truck Stop and Cafe. Now, for the record, I love non-corporate truck stops, and there are still many out there, but they are a dying breed, especially when they feature a mom and pop diner. I've now been here on two separate occasions, and it hasn't disappointed me either time. The place has a kind of late 70s/early 80s charm to it. Tables on tile floor, art painted on wood trimmed walls. Feels comfy and familiar to me. My first go around, was late in the evening, and I was feeling breakfast, so I strolled up to the counter and looked at the menu. I'm a sucker for a good omelette, so I went with the Western omelette, and smothered it and the hash browns both in country gravy, so that's what I ordered. One of the things I love about truck stops is the large portions for a good price, and in today's economy, there's nothing wrong with that. I paid for the omelette, and found a table, and a few minutes later the girl who took my order brought it to me, with an exceptionally large glass of water. I dug into it, and while the egg was a little thin and not quite fluffy enough, it was stuffed with enough peppers, onions, sausage, bacon and cheese to make it filling enough on its own. The toast and hash browns were just a little something extra. But I ate every bite on that plate. That gravy was worth the extra cost and tied the whole thing together nicely. I was sated, and perhaps a little food drunk when I left. Today, I tried the Chili Cheese fries. Again, I paid at the counter and again they brought it to me, with that large glass of water accompanying it. The chili was obviously homemade and was of the beef variety without a bean to be found, there was plenty of cheese on it, and onions too! (Which I added to it.) it also was delicious and well portioned. Both times here, the service was friendly and great, and I left feeling full. Absolutely no complaints about this place. And since it's on my work route, I'm sure I'll be there again to try other things.
